NEW YORK, Jan. 24 /PRNewswire/ -- Manhattan Scientifics, Inc. (MHTX) announced today that it has entered into a joint agreement
with Electrolux LLC and Lunar Design, Inc. to develop an evaluation prototype of a fuel cell powered vacuum cleaner for the home.

Manhattan Scientifics is to design and build the prototype fuel cell to power a unique portable vacuum cleaner. This advanced home
appliance is intended to free the user from electric cords and A/C wall plugs while providing full power cleaning performance. The
unit's light weight and low noise coupled with total freedom of movement throughout the home or business are potentially strong
distinctive features in the market share battle for high-end vacuum cleaners.

The company announced last month that it has entered into an agreement with Aprilia, S.p.A., one of Europe's largest manufacturers
of motor scooters and motorcycles, to develop a fuel cell powered concept bicycle. Aprilia unveiled the bicycle, a version of
Manhattan Scientifics' Hydrocycle(TM) bicycle, in December at the Bologna Motor Show in Italy.
